Output 91f05e34f527ba8775b82e21bc0b5e6122fbd7ed3d69307d01d0300a46b80346:0

value
1417525792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686f61038a4eeaed8662aa63de567ca50f59e1b1 OP_EQUAL
address
MHRMw8HQ295oWvxC7oph72VVDbwZLkLHqy
transaction
91f05e34f527ba8775b82e21bc0b5e6122fbd7ed3d69307d01d0300a46b80346
spent
true